New Method for Low Power Sequential Circuit Design Based on Clock Gating

XU Yang,SHEN Ji-zhong
DOI: https://doi.org/10.3785/j.issn.1008-973x.2010.09.016
2010-01-01
Abstract:A new method based on clock gating technique was proposed to achieve a more optimal low power design for sequential circuit.First of all,obtain the circuit's behavior Karnaugh maps from the next states table or the state-transition diagram.Gate the redundant clock properly according to the actual situation,and gain the redundancy restraining signal.Some redundant clock needn't be blocked if the gating cost is too high.After that,change the marked maintain condition into don't-care condition,draw the next Karnaugh maps of flip-flops,and obtain the excitation functions.Finally,draw the circuit diagram based on the redundancy restraining signal and excitation functions,and make sure that the circuit can self-start.8421 binary coded decimal (BCD) synchronous decimal up counter and three bit Johnson counter as practical design examples using this new method were studied and simulated by Hspice.Simulation shows that these designs have correct logic function and can achieve large energy saving.Compared to existing designs,the proposed designs have either lower power dissipation or improved performance.
What problem does this paper attempt to address?